WBP1LP1, short for WW domain binding protein 1-like pseudogene 1, is a pseudogene found in the human genome[4]. Pseudogenes are DNA sequences similar to known genes but usually lack the ability to encode functional proteins due to sequence disruptions or regulatory mutations. WBP1LP1 is related to the WW domain binding protein 1-like family, but it does not produce a functional protein product and has not been implicated in cellular signaling, disease, or therapeutic targeting. There is no evidence that this pseudogene serves as a receptor, enzyme, transporter, biomarker, or pharmacological target. Most of the research and functional insights are related to WBP1L (WW domain binding protein 1-like, a transmembrane adaptor protein with established roles in hematopoietic stem cells and leukemia prognosis)[1], but WBP1LP1 itself lacks documented biological or clinical relevance. If a therapeutic or biological context is intended, WBP1L (not a pseudogene) is likely the correct target[1]; WBP1LP1 appears to be non-functional and not suitable for structured molecular or pharmacological annotation.
